A 5-year spine-device warranty? Titan Spine is all in

 Titan Spine now offers a warranty for its Endoskeleton line of spinal interbody fusion devices for a one-time free replacement.

The warranty will give the replacement for any eligible Titan spinal interbody fusion device if revision surgery is required within a five-year period, as outlined in the terms of the warranty agreement. This is an extremely unique offering in the spine device space, where companies are looking for new ways to draw potential customers. The healthcare system is looking to eliminate revision procedures to improve quality and lower costs, and a company willing to back-up their outcomes with a warranty could be very attractive.

 

The Endoskeleton devices include the company's proprietary implant surface technology with a unique combination of roughened topographies at the macro, micro and cellular levels designed to create an optimal host-bone response and actively participate in the fusion process.

 

The implant encourages the natural production of bone morphogenetic proteins for a faster and more robust fusion.

 

"In my experience this is the first time that a device company in the spine market has offered such a guarantee," said Titan Spine Chief Medical Officer Paul Slosar, MD. "The warranty highlights the recognition that our engineered spine implants continue to lead the surface technology space."

 

The company received feedback on the warranty to show confidence in company products and the science validating its technology. The company recently received FDA clearance for the TL lateral system and the Whitecloud Award for Best Basic Research from the Scoliosis Research Society.

 

"We look forward to accelerating momentum by providing our physician customers an additional reason to trust that our products will successfully perform in patients," says Titan Spine CEO Peter Ulllrich, MD.
